Southwest Airlines Boeing 737-700 Engine Failure

On August 15, 2023, a Southwest Airlines Boeing 737-700 performing flight from Houston Hobby to Cancun suffered an engine failure shortly after takeoff. The video showed that the number 2 engine was expulsing flames. The crew shut down the engine and returned safely to Houston Hobby Airport.
